Quitman chamber seeks Christmas sponsors

Posted

The Quitman Chamber of Commerce is making plans for another holiday season preparing for 2022 Hometown Christmas activities Dec. 3.

One of the ways to become involved is through sponsorship of the event.

The Christmas parade sponsor has been taken by Laser Line. There was only one parade sponsorship available at a cost of $2,000. It includes a banner with business logo preceding the parade; audio recognition at the event; recognition on social media outlets; and participation in the Christmas Wreath Program.

Two Santa sponsorships have also already been purchased at $1,000 each, Seth’s Lake Fork Creek along with Peoples Telephone. They will receive title sponsorship with logo included on materials; audio recognition at the event; recognition on social media outlets; participation in the Wreath Program; banner with logo on display; and a 10x10 booth space at event.

 Rudolph and Elf sponsorships are still available. The Rudolph sponsor is $500 and those participants receive recognition on social media; name listed on brochures and materials concerning the event; an ornament sign with name on display; and participation in the Wreath Program.

The Elf sponsorship is $250 and includes a window sign at the business and the sponsor’s name listed on brochures and materials about the event.

Christmas Wreaths for a business or home are $100 per wreath the first year and a wreath renewal is $35 per wreath. Wreaths will be placed at the business or home after Thanksgiving and will be in place until Jan. 1.

This is the third year for the celebration which has brought hundreds of people to the courthouse square.
